`Usage
Call
animate, the default exported function, with your callback and use returned object to manage your animation.`js
import animate from '@bitty/animate';const canvas = document.querySelector('canvas');
const context = canvas.getContext('2d');
const position = { x: 0, y: 0 };
const animation = animate(() => {
context.clearRect(0, 0, canvas.width, canvas.height);
context.beginPath();
context.arc(position.x, position.y, 100 / 2, 0, 2 * Math.PI);
context.fillStyle = '#000000';
context.fill();
context.closePath();
});
window.addEventListener('mousemove', (event) => {
position.x = event.clientX;
position.y = event.clientY;
});
animation.start();
`> See this example on Codepen.
API
-
animate The default exported function, which receives
callback as argument and returns an Animation. -
callback is a synchronous function running into a AnimationFrame recursion.
`js
let count = 0; const animation = animate(() => {
context.clearRect(0, 0, element.width, element.height);
context.font = '4rem monospace';
context.textAlign = 'center';
context.fillText(count, element.width / 2, element.height / 2);
count++;
});
animation.start();
` > See this example on Codepen.
TypeScript type definitions.
`ts
export default function animate(callback: () => void): Animation;
`
-
Animation An object returned by
animate function to manage your animations. It can start, stop and check if animation is running. -
running: A getter property that indicates if animation is running. -
start(): A method to start the animation. -
stop(): A method to stop the animation.
`js
const animation = animate(() => { ... }); animation.start();
// Stops the animation after 10s
setTimeout(() => animation.stop(), 10 * 1000);
if (animation.running)
console.log('The animation is running...');
`
TypeScript type definitions.
`ts
export interface Animation {
readonly running: boolean;
stop: () => void;
start: () => void;
}
